Regular maintenance checks is essential for keeping your vehicle running smoothly and safely. A well-maintained car not only operates optimally, but it also reduces the risk of costly repairs down the road. By following the recommended servicing schedule in your vehicle's logbook, you can ensure that all vital components are examined regularly and repaired promptly.
This proactive approach can help prolong the lifespan of your vehicle, while also reducing fuel costs and improving overall performance. Keep in mind that regular servicing isn't just about keeping your car running; it's also about ensuring a safe and comfortable driving experience.

Roadworthy Inspections: Pass with Confidence Every Time
Passing a roadworthy inspection can seem daunting, but it doesn't have to be. By familiarizing yourself with the essential requirements and performing some basic inspections, you can smoothly prepare your vehicle for a successful inspection. Remember that a thorough roadworthy inspection ensures not only that your vehicle meets legal standards but also that it's reliable to drive, protecting both you and other motorists.
- Prior to the Inspection: Inspect your vehicle's lights, brakes, tires, windshield, and coolant/oil/brake fluid levels.
- At the time of the Inspection: Be there to answer any questions the inspector may have about your vehicle's history or repairs.
- After the Inspection: If any issues are found, address them promptly to ensure your vehicle remains roadworthy and safe.
The Importance of Preventative Maintenance Logbooks
Implementing a structured preventative maintenance logbook can significantly reduce downtime and expenditures in the long run. By diligently recording routine checks and adjustments, you gain invaluable insight into your equipment's health. This facilitates proactive maintenance, preventing unexpected breakdowns and minimizing costly repairs.
- A well-maintained logbook improves the scheduling of maintenance tasks, ensuring that critical systems are serviced on time.
- Recording maintenance history provides useful data for evaluating equipment performance and identifying potential concerns early on.
- Preventative maintenance logbooks enhance overall equipment reliability, leading to increased productivity and reduced interruptions.
